WebSimilar to garages in this instance, carports are classed as outbuildings, which generally fall under ‘permitted development’ rights. So, as long as your new carport sticks to the following rules, you shouldn’t need to apply for planning permission. Your carport is not built on land in front of a wall that is in front of the house.

Web27 mrt. 2024 · Outbuildings are not allowed on land in front of a wall that forms the principal elevation. With buildings, containers, and enclosures found on designated land (including natural parks and other conservation areas), planning permissions will be required. Any outbuilding within the curtilage of a listed building will require planning permission.

A lean to shed is a storage structure that connects to an existing structure (e.g., a barn, fence, garage, house, or wall). Infact the name “lean to” was originally used as the sheds of the time had only three walls and needed another building to lean on to stay erect. green wave solomonsWebBuilding permit application, information and forms to include with your application.
